Mar 2017 – Healthway Medical receives S$8.6 million from Gateway

Healthway Medical Corporation (HMC) has finally received the net proceeds of the first tranche of a S$70 million (US$50 million) convertible notes deal with Gateway Partners to solve its immediate cash needs, such as paying doctors’ and nurses’ salaries.

Mar 2017 – Carro lands US$12 million

Carro.sg, SEA’s leading transactional auto marketplace based in Singapore raised US$12 million in its latest round of funding. The funding will go towards developing Genie Financial Services, a hire purchase provider that offers speedy auto loan approvals and artificial intelligence (AI) based chat-bots to customers. The investors included Venturra, Singtel Innnov8, Golden Gate Ventures and Alpha JWC.

Mar 2017 – World Bank’s IFC investment firm invested US$2 million in SeedPlus (an SEA Fund)

IFC confirmed that it has invested US$2 million in the SeedPlus fund. SeedPlus reportedly has a fund size of US$20 million in 2015.

Mar 2017 – Singapore SaaS startup Ematic raised US$2.4 million to enhance AI-based email marketing tools

Singapore-based SaaS email marketing company Ematic Solutions has raised US$2.4 million. Walden International, as well as existing investors Wavemaker Partners, MDI Ventures and Convergence Ventures took part in this fresh funding. Ematic has raised a total of US$4.4 million to date.

Mar 2017 – Citic Capital Partners eyes US$2 Billion close for latest China buyout fund

Citic Capital Partners, the buyout arm of Chinese alternative investment manager Citic Capital, is nearing a US$2 billion close on its third China-focused buyout fund.

Mar 2017 – Dymon Asia announces first close of its debut US$50 million fund for fintech

Hedge fund Dymon Asia is getting into the venture capital game after it announced its maiden fund. Dymon Asia Ventures is focused on fintech deals and it is targeting a $50 million raise. Dymon Asia said a final close of the fund will happen over the next 12 months.
